- [ ] **Step 7: Breaker override escrow.** After sealing the signing keys for the Tallgrove upstream API circuit breaker, confirm the support team can force the breaker open during a full outage. The override bundle lives in the sealed escrow drawer and is useless without its unlock phrase. Two ceremony witnesses must initial this step before proceeding. The escrow bundle is decrypted with the recovery passphrase that follows.

vault phrase of kahip-kahop = holath-quenmir

## Calendar Sync Conflicts

When Meridwell's sync engine detects the same event edited in two connected calendars, it holds both versions in a conflict queue rather than overwriting either. New team members should review this queue daily during onboarding. Inspecting it requires calling the internal resolution service, which authenticates via a key. That key is provided below.

gateway credential: kto23_LX9A4ys6i4nzHtpOLNLodKK

Runbook: Mistlewood digest scheduler recovery. Symptom: batch email digests stop firing after a failed deploy; the scheduler account locks on repeated auth failures. Steps: pause the digest queue, confirm no partial sends in the outbox, then restart the scheduler pod. Do not reset cron offsets — subscribers in the Ostbridge region are pinned to 06:00 local. Re-authenticate the scheduler account via the recovery console using the passphrase given below.

unlock words, yawig-kagef: gordor-holvan-ulaael-pramir-ulaiel-tamdor